image
Industrials - Consulting Services - NASDAQ - US
$ 10.95
-1.17 %
$ 208 M
Market Cap
-36.5
P/E
FORR - REVENUE

Revenue FORR - Forrester Research, Inc.

image
481 M
LAST VALUE
-1.38%
2 YEAR CAGR
6.10%
5 YEAR CAGR
4.91%
10 YEAR CAGR